After merging this in, to actually see the fixed line-endings in your working tree, you'll need to clear out your working directory, and then restore everything again by doing this:
(N.B. this will clear out any uncommitted changes you have on your branch).
git rm -r ./* && git reset --hard
Then if you open bin/index.js you should see that the line-endings are just LF rather than CR+LF. I tested this in Notepad++ (View > Show Symbol > Show End of Line).
